Developing an AI-Powered VR Chatbot for Immersive Medical English Training and Beyond

Time not set

This poster session will detail the design and development of an innovative AI-Powered Virtual Reality Chatbot, specifically created for English-speaking practice. The VR simulation application aims to provide an immersive and interactive platform for EFL learners to enhance their English communication skills without a need for an English speaking human partner. This VR simulation can be applied to any speaking scenario. Here, we created a VR medical environment for the purpose of training for interviewing a patient in English, where the chatbot will play the role of the patient.

The poster covers key aspects of the development process, including the integration of text-to-speech and speech-to-text technology to successfully communicate with the AI (ChatGPT) patient, the creation of the 3D VR environment, the implementation of user-friendly controls, and design decisions based on feedback from experts in medical education. Preliminary user testing results and feedback are shared, highlighting the application's potential to improve medical English proficiency, to address the lack of human speaking practice partners and to reduce language learning anxiety.

Participants will have the opportunity to experience the simulation themselves.
